Egypt receives vaccine doses via France
The AstraZeneca vaccine doses were delivered via the World Health Organization's COVAX initiative.

Egypt has received hundreds of thousands of COVID-19 vaccine doses via the World Health Organization.
Health Minister Hala Zayed said Sunday that the delivery from the WHO’s COVAX program consisted of 546,400 doses of the British-Swedish AstraZeneca vaccine, according to a Ministry of Health and Population statement.
